US July CPI Forecast: 0.2% MoM, Core 2.5% YoY

US July CPI data is expected to show headline inflation at 0.2% month-over-month and 3.4% year-over-year, with core inflation at 0.2% m/m and 2.5% y/y, setting the tone for Fed policy expectations.

Today’s US July CPI release is the most anticipated data point, with economists forecasting a steady monthly increase in prices after a sharp decline in June.

Headline inflation is projected at 0.2% m/m seasonally adjusted, bringing the annual rate to 3.4% — down from 3.5% in June but a reversal from the prior month’s -0.4% m/m print. Core CPI, which strips out food and energy, is seen also rising 0.2% m/m, pushing the yearly pace to 2.5% from 2.6%.

The numbers will be closely watched for clues on the Fed’s next move. A firmer m/m reading could dent hopes for imminent rate cuts, while a softer print might reinforce the disinflation narrative.
